In a world on the brink of chaos, "The Angel of the Revolution" by George Chetwynd Griffith transports readers to a gripping tale of futuristic warfare, political intrigue, and the relentless pursuit of a utopian vision. As the mysterious and charismatic Natas leads a revolutionary brotherhood against the oppressive forces of a global empire, the fate of humanity hangs in the balance. With airships soaring through the skies and advanced technology reshaping the battlefield, this prophetic narrative explores themes of power, freedom, and the ethical implications of technological advancements. Griffith's visionary storytelling resonates deeply with contemporary society, reflecting our own struggles with authoritarianism, the quest for social justice, and the ethical dilemmas posed by rapid technological progress. "The Angel of the Revolution" is a thrilling journey that challenges readers to question the cost of revolution and the true meaning of progress in an ever-evolving world.
